python移植安卓
① 如何在python中导入Android模块
应该先下载一个android模块,再导供袱垛惶艹耗讹同番括入。我的也是:ImportError: No mole named android
找不到模块,你环境变量设置的有问题吧。如果没有在默认的python lib目录下,你应该要手工加进去的。
② 可以用Python开发安卓吗
我们知道了Python可以开发桌面应用(PyQt、wxPython等),可以开发服务端(twisted等),可以开发web端(Django、Flask等),开发爬虫(pyspider等),开发硬件stm32(PyBoard等),是一个全栈开发语言。那么可以用Python开发安卓吗?
可以用Python开发安卓吗
Python可以开发安卓应用。
我们可以使用kivy开发安卓APP,Kivy是一套专门用于跨平台快速应用开发的开源框架,使用Python和Cython编写,对于多点触控有着非常良好的支持,不仅能让开发者快速完成简洁的交互原型设计,还支持代码重用和部署,绝对是一款颇让人惊艳的NUI框架。
因为跨平台的,所以只写一遍代码,就可以同时生成安卓及iOS的APP。
Kivy是开源Python函式库,用于开发行动应用程序和其它采用自然用户界面的多点触控应用软件。它可以在Android,iOS,Linux,OS X和Windows执行。采用MIT授权条款,Kivy是自由并且开源的软件。
Kivy的主要架构由Kivy组织开发,并有Python用于Android,Kivy iOS和其它许多函式库被使用在所有平台。在2012年,Kivy从Python软件基金会获得$5000美元补助,用于移植Kivy到Python 3.3。Kivy也支援由Bountysource赞助的树莓派。
更多技术请关注Python视频教程。
③ 塞班的python与安卓的python有何区别,能把塞班的python程序移植到安卓吗
python解释器本身用c/c++实现的,所以对于语言的核心部分,塞班的python与安卓的python是一样的,但是因为运行的操作系统不同,所以对应系统提供的专有的库肯定是不同的(例如创建界面环境的库),如果是十分依赖系统的库也应该是有差距的。
塞班的python程序不带界面的移植比较容易,但是带界面的移植也不能说完全不可能,但是难度肯定是非常大的。
④ 如何让自己在电脑上写的python脚本在手机或安卓系统上运行
你好
python可以运行在android上.因为可以在android上安装一个python runtime就OK啦!就好比python也可以运行在symbina、windows mobile、plam os 、arm的blackberry一样。原生的android应用是用java写的。毕竟android系统也是用java写的
如果你可以用python写一个手机操作系统那么也很棒哦。哈~(题外话),总得来说.可以编写安卓程序(好像是说以后android默认会内置python解释器,
意思就是说不需要额外的安装python到手机里面也可以直接运行py程序了哦
满意请采纳
⑤ 求助,现在可行的python电脑端向android端移植的方案
在android上运行python脚本,或者在android上使用python交互界面,对熟悉python的研究或开发人员来说,是一件很有吸引力的事情,因为python脚本真是非常高效,另外,有很多非常好的库
android官方目前没有支持在android设备运行python,但是网上有一些项目组做了这个事情 这个链接就提供好几个项目,我稍微尝试了 Kivy 这种方式, 需要安装
的东西太多,就放弃了. 推荐 这种方式,使用 qpython 项目, 可以用非常少的付出得到 android 上可以运行的 python 环境.
5 relogin the shell
6. type python in the adb shell
root@generic:/ # python // 我尝试的时候,直接运行 python (其实是运行 /data/data/com.hipipal.qpyplus/files/bin/python ) 会报错: error: only position independent executables (PIE) are supported. 我测试的设备是 Nexus 6 , android 6.0 , 在
这些比较新的 android 系统上有保护,需要可执行程序使用 -PIE 进行编译,否则无法运行. 但我发现同样的目录下 python-android5 是可以运行的, 所以就 mv python python.bak ; ln -s python-android5 python ; 这样后面就可以直接运行 python 了.
⑥ python文件可以转安卓手机用吗
python语言应用很广泛,自己也很喜欢使用它,其实我们也可以直接在自己的安卓手机上做python开发学习,只需要简单的配置下环境就可以了。
开启分步阅读模式
操作方法
01
首先我们可以在手机上安装qpython3。
02
接着我们可以直接选择“
终端”。
03
在这里面我们可以直接一行一行输入执行代码。
04
我们也可以选择进入“
编辑器”。
05
直接输入我们的python脚本代码。
06
然后点击底部的“
执行”按钮,就可以运行脚本了,并输出“
你好”。
07
我们也可以选择进入“
程序”,在里面有好多的案例供我们学习使用。
08
点击后选择“
Run”就可以执行程序,选择“open”可以查看案例的代码方便学习。
⑦ 如何在安卓上安装Python
Termux可以装Python模块,还有个Q Python3
⑧ 如何让自己在电脑上写的python脚本在手机或安卓系统上运行呢
对于如何让自己在电脑上写的python脚本在手机或安卓系统上运行呢??我有下面的看法。
操作过程
9、在终端输入adb设备。如果您看到以下信息,adb安装正确,计算机成功地检测到电话。如果您的系统是Win10或Win8,您可能需要首先设置“禁用强制驱动签名”。
10,打开微信启动,输入python wechat_jump_auto。在终端的py,游戏将自动启动。请运行相应的*。py文件根据电话分辨率。
注意:
不要沉迷于刷分,分数太高反而会被系统清零。而且也要注意日常的娱乐,不要总是玩手机。
⑨ python能开发ios与安卓吗
python能开发ios与安卓吗?
python能开发ios与安卓,用Python写安卓APP肯定不是最好的选择,但是肯定是一个很偷懒的选择
我们使用kivy开发安卓APP,Kivy是一套专门用于跨平台快速应用开发的开源框架,使用Python和Cython编写,对于多点触控有着非常良好的支持,不仅能让开发者快速完成简洁的交互原型设计,还支持代码重用和部署,绝对是一款颇让人惊艳的NUI框架。
因为跨平台的,所以只写一遍代码,就可以同时生成安卓及IOS的APP,很酷吧。
推荐:【Python教程】
Kivy简介
Kivy的主要架构由Kivy组织开发,并有Python用于Android,Kivy iOS和其它许多函式库被使用在所有平台。在2012年,Kivy从Python软件基金会获得$5000美元补助,用于移植Kivy到Python 3.3。Kivy也支援由Bountysource赞助的树莓派。
其架构包括所有建造应用程序的元素,例如:
支援许多种输入,例如鼠标,键盘、触控式使用者界面(TUIO)和特定操作系统的多重触控事件,只采用OpenGL ES 2的图形函式库,且根基于向量缓冲物件(Vertex Buffer Object)和着色器,支援多点触控的庞大控件,一个中间语言(Kv)用来简化客制控件的设计。
Kivy改良了PyMT专案,并且推荐给新的专案采用。以上就是小编分享的关于python能开发ios与安卓吗的详细内容希望对大家有所帮助,更多有关python教程请关注环球青藤其它相关文章!
⑩ 写完python代码后,如何把他安装到android虚拟机里SL4A里面去
这个是利用adb工具的push命令,把你的脚本拷贝到你目标机器的/sdcard/sl4a/scripts目录
就是打开命令行程序
cd到你安装adb的那个目录(如果是利用的androidSDK里面的adb,就是去androidSDK目录的platform-tools子目录,如果是单独拷贝的adb工具,就去它所在的子目录)
然后输入adb push yourscriptpath /sdcard/sl4a/scripts
这里的yourscriptpath是你的脚本的全路径
这个命令只是拷贝而已,其实你把安卓设备usb连接上,然后直接拷贝过去也是一样的。